Hmmmm If you have gotten gas in the oil (How do you know) I would be worried. A head gasket wouldn't do this. You would have to be getting gas past the piston rings,or down a valve guide which would also allow oil up into cyclinder head.
Does it burn oil (Smoke alot from exhaust)

Keeps running but your getting gas out of the carb and running out of the air filter has just got to be a float.
What i would do, with the engine cool, Is pull off the air filter and everything i can so i can see the carbs (Intake/filter side opening),
Then start the bike (Be ready to kill it) and see if it isnt comming out of a particular carb, i bet it is (Thats why it will still run) , that carb will most likely have a float stuck. You need to let me know what happens.
